Sarah Harvey
HR Trainer and Consultant


Sarah Harvey is a much sought after Human Resources Trainer and Consultant for
Employee Centric, with an emphasis in Management Training and Development. With
over 20 years of Human Resources experience, she has led management
development programs with companies like Capital One, Circuit City, J. Sargeant
Reynolds Community College, Johnson & Johnson, Cordis, Baxter Healthcare, and
Ryder Systems. Sarah earned an MBA degree from the University of Miami while
working full-time and has a BA in Psychology from the University of Virginia. Sarah has
practical work experience in project management and all aspects of training and
development. Her experience includes needs assessment, curriculum design, course
development, and delivery for both web-based e-learning and instructor-led training.

As a professional trainer, Sarah has designed and delivered various training programs
for employees including, but not limited to: strategic thinking, critical analysis and
problem solving, performance management,progressive discipline and terminations,
delagation, behavioral interviewing, time management, working with the generations,
effective communication, teambuilding, employee orientation, presentation skills,
meeting effectiveness, supervisory skills, FMLA, EEOC, Preventing Harassment, Total
Quality Management (TQM), Good Manufacturing Practices (GMPs), and safety. In
addition to training, Sarah has implemented a record tracking database, 360-degree
feedback process, performance management systems, and bonus/compensation
systems.
